Transaction 35e830b33ba3b8477965ece058d824b8910296301d0115425efc7d592e0762f6

1 Input
2 Outputs
  • 35e830b33ba3b8477965ece058d824b8910296301d0115425efc7d592e0762f6:0
  • value  578450
    address  1JHAbKFoaD9qji3NuKaygYTEd3wPqFtCYT
  • 35e830b33ba3b8477965ece058d824b8910296301d0115425efc7d592e0762f6:1
  • value  10243822
    address  1NUPmg3LVpbPoinkMwBkLYFMKYMZUcWFBM